public static final class OptimizeRestoredTableMetadata.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der> implements OptimizeRestoredTableMetadataOrBuilder
Metadata type for the long-running operation used to track the progress of optimizations performed on a newly restored table. This long-running operation is automatically created by the system after the successful completion of a table restore, and cannot be cancelled.Protobuf type
google.bigtable.admin.v2.OptimizeRestoredTableMetadata| Modifier and Type | Method and Description |
|---|---|
OptimizeRestoredTableMetadata.Builder |
add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
OptimizeRestoredTableMetadata |
build() |
OptimizeRestoredTableMetadata |
buildPartial() |
OptimizeRestoredTableMetadata.Builder |
clear() |
OptimizeRestoredTableMetadata.Builder |
clearField(com.google.protobuf.Descriptors.FieldDescriptor field) |
OptimizeRestoredTableMetadata.Builder |
clearName()
Name of the restored table being optimized.
|
OptimizeRestoredTableMetadata.Builder |
cl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of) |
OptimizeRestoredTableMetadata.Builder |
clearProgress()
The progress of the post-restore optimizations.
|
OptimizeRestoredTableMetadata.Builder |
clone() |
OptimizeRestoredTableMetadata |
getDefaultInstanceForType() |
static com.google.protobuf.Descriptors.Descriptor |
getDescriptor() |
com.google.protobuf.Descriptors.Descriptor |
getDescriptorForType() |
String |
getName()
Name of the restored table being optimized.
|
com.google.protobuf.ByteString |
getNameBytes()
Name of the restored table being optimized.
|
OperationProgress |
getProgress()
The progress of the post-restore optimizations.
|
OperationProgress.Builder |
getProgressBuilder()
The progress of the post-restore optimizations.
|
OperationProgressOrBuilder |
getProgressOrBuilder()
The progress of the post-restore optimizations.
|
boolean |
hasProgress()
The progress of the post-restore optimizations.
|
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able |
internalGetFieldAccessorTable() |
boolean |
isInitialized() |
OptimizeRestoredTableMetadata.Builder |
mergeFrom(com.google.protobuf.CodedInputStream input,
com.google.protobuf.ExtensionRegistryLite extensionRegistry) |
OptimizeRestoredTableMetadata.Builder |
mergeFrom(com.google.protobuf.Message other) |
OptimizeRestoredTableMetadata.Builder |
mergeFrom(OptimizeRestoredTableMetadata other) |
OptimizeRestoredTableMetadata.Builder |
mergeProgress(OperationProgress value)
The progress of the post-restore optimizations.
|
OptimizeRestoredTableMetadata.Builder |
m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
OptimizeRestoredTableMetadata.Builder |
setField(com.google.protobuf.Descriptors.FieldDescriptor field,
Object value) |
OptimizeRestoredTableMetadata.Builder |
setName(String value)
Name of the restored table being optimized.
|
OptimizeRestoredTableMetadata.Builder |
setNameBytes(com.google.protobuf.ByteString value)
Name of the restored table being optimized.
|
OptimizeRestoredTableMetadata.Builder |
setProgress(OperationProgress.Builder builderForValue)
The progress of the post-restore optimizations.
|
OptimizeRestoredTableMetadata.Builder |
setProgress(OperationProgress value)
The progress of the post-restore optimizations.
|
OptimizeRestoredTableMetadata.Builder |
set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field,
int index,
Object value) |
OptimizeRestoredTableMetadata.Builder |
set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ields) |
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toStringaddA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ageExceptionequals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itfindInitializationErrors, getAllFields,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neofp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ic OptimizeRestoredTableMetadata build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ic OptimizeRestoredTableMetadata bu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ic OptimizeRestoredTableMetadata.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
setField in interface com.google.protobuf.Message.BuildersetField in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
clearField in interface com.google.protobuf.Message.BuilderclearField in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
clearOneof in interface com.google.protobuf.Message.BuilderclearOneof in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
setRepeatedField in interface com.google.protobuf.Message.BuildersetR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
addRepeatedField in interface com.google.protobuf.Message.BuilderaddRepeatedField in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der mergeFrom(OptimizeRestoredTableMetadata other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public OptimizeRestoredTableMetadata.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<OptimizeRestoredTableMetadata.Builder>IOExceptionpublic String getName()
Name of the restored table being optimized.
string name = 1;getName in interface OptimizeRestoredTableMetadataOrBuilderpublic com.google.protobuf.ByteString getNameBytes()
Name of the restored table being optimized.
string name = 1;getNameBytes in interface OptimizeRestoredTableMetadataOrBuilderpublic OptimizeRestoredTableMetadata.Builder setName(String value)
Name of the restored table being optimized.
string name = 1;value - The name to set.public OptimizeRestoredTableMetadata.Builder clearName()
Name of the restored table being optimized.
string name = 1;public OptimizeRestoredTableMetadata.Builder setNameBytes(com.google.protobuf.ByteString value)
Name of the restored table being optimized.
string name = 1;value - The bytes for name to set.public boolean hasProgress()
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;hasProgress in interface OptimizeRestoredTableMetadataOrBuilderpublic OperationProgress getProgress()
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;getProgress in interface OptimizeRestoredTableMetadataOrBuilderpublic OptimizeRestoredTableMetadata.Builder setProgress(OperationProgress value)
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;public OptimizeRestoredTableMetadata.Builder setProgress(OperationProgress.Builder builderForValue)
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;public OptimizeRestoredTableMetadata.Builder mergeProgress(OperationProgress value)
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;public OptimizeRestoredTableMetadata.Builder clearProgress()
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;public OperationProgress.Builder getProgressBuilder()
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;public OperationProgressOrBuilder getProgressOrBuilder()
The progress of the post-restore optimizations.
.google.bigtable.admin.v2.OperationProgress progress = 2;getProgressOrBuilder in interface OptimizeRestoredTableMetadataOrBuilderpublic final OptimizeRestoredTableMetadata.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
setUnknownFields in interface com.google.protobuf.Message.BuildersetU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>public final OptimizeRestoredTableMetadata.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
mergeUnknownFields in interface com.google.protobuf.Message.BuildermergeUnknownFields in class com.google.protobuf.GeneratedMessageV3.Builder<OptimizeRestoredTableMetadata.Builder>Copyright © 2023 Google LLC. All rights reserved.